Ticket: Staging env misconfigured for Siftgate bloom filter

The bloom layer in front of the Pellet KV store is rejecting all lookups in staging because the env file was copied from the dev template without credentials. False-positive tuning values are fine; only the auth line is missing. To unblock the weekly demo, the Pellet admission secret must be set on the following line.

env line for yaguf-fajop: LEDGER_TOKEN13=fb08984397349

The Brightlane Analytics summer intern cohort arrives Monday at 08:30, roughly twenty people. Please direct them to the Cedar Room on level two for orientation with Marta Vey. Interns will not have permanent badges until Wednesday, so escort any stragglers personally. To open the Cedar Room wing door, use the code below.

badge for fafop-fajof: bdg-Z-47

Welcome aboard — here's the quick picture. Margins slipped to 31% this quarter, mostly down to freight increases on the Corvale routes and some overly generous discounting by the Ashmere branch. We've tightened discount approvals and renegotiated two carrier contracts, which should claw back about two points by spring. Product mix is shifting toward the Lenna range, which helps. Full workings are in the shared folder. The confidential note below covers where we're headed next.

confidential, kagep-kahof: Druokax Systems plans to lower the Ulaath list price by 53 percent in March.

The Lanternfold service now builds under the hermetic Quarrel build system. All dependencies are pinned and fetched from the internal mirror; network access during builds is disabled, so undeclared inputs fail fast. New team members should run the bootstrap script once, then use the standard build target for deploys. Releases are promoted from the staging channel after smoke tests pass; rollbacks use the previous pinned artifact. Before your first deploy, confirm your environment matches the service configuration values shown below.

settings of fadup-kajog:
[casox]
port = 3000
team = jorix
host = casox.paliqio.example
region = lower-4
access_code = ac_dd069a
timeout_ms = 750